And excellent resource for anyone interested in diet and nutrition--although perhaps this 2003 books is of less utility in the day of the internet where much of this information is a click (or app) away. Contains thousands of alphabetically organized listings, including brand-name, frozen and fast food items and featuring calorie counts, grams of carbs, proteins, fats and fiber, sodium and cholesterol and calories.
